Output 6096bc22aa70afefdf00cf05a7e646e046d088ca1ae2c332579069237133827f:1

value
20425785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69b854696f66ab76cfb00390b5ac70ba70e37fb3 OP_EQUAL
address
A25GRzAQ8EUFERjKMHTvEmQwSt7tzFeQzs
transaction
6096bc22aa70afefdf00cf05a7e646e046d088ca1ae2c332579069237133827f